At the heart of this biological shift lies the endocrine system, a sophisticated network of glands and hormones governing nearly every bodily function. As chronological age advances, key hormonal levels diminish. Testosterone levels in men, for instance, experience a gradual decline, impacting muscle mass, bone density, and physical function.
Women experience significant hormonal shifts during menopause, particularly reductions in estradiol, which influences bone health and metabolic function. These hormonal fluctuations contribute to a spectrum of symptoms ∞ persistent fatigue, diminished cognitive clarity, altered body composition, and a general reduction in physical and mental resilience.
Metabolic health, a cornerstone of sustained vitality, undergoes significant transformation with age. Adipose tissue dysfunction, reduced mitochondrial efficiency, and alterations in nutrient-sensing pathways become more prevalent. These shifts contribute to insulin resistance and a pro-inflammatory state, creating an internal environment less conducive to peak performance.
The body’s cellular machinery, once operating with precision, experiences wear. Cellular senescence, where cells cease healthy division yet persist, releasing inflammatory molecules, becomes a hallmark of advancing age. This accumulation of senescent cells directly contributes to the progression of age-related conditions.

Peptide science offers a powerful avenue for targeted biological adjustments. Peptides are short chains of amino acids functioning as signaling molecules, influencing a spectrum of biological processes from cellular communication to immune response.
- Sermorelin ∞ This peptide stimulates the body’s natural production of growth hormone, contributing to improved bone density, muscle strength, metabolic function, and sleep quality. It works by mimicking growth hormone-releasing hormone, signaling the pituitary gland to release growth hormone.
- BPC-157 ∞ Known for its healing properties, BPC-157 promotes tissue repair and regeneration across various systems, including muscles, tendons, and the gastrointestinal tract. Its anti-inflammatory effects reduce pain and accelerate recovery from injuries.

A precision-based approach mandates comprehensive diagnostics. Advanced lab testing evaluates levels of key hormones, including testosterone, DHEA, estrogen, progesterone, thyroid hormones, cortisol, and IGF-1. This granular data informs personalized protocols, ensuring interventions are tailored to an individual’s unique physiological profile. Geroscience, the study of the biological mechanisms of aging, offers a framework for understanding how interventions can delay physiological consequences, maintain function, and prevent frailty. This field identifies inflammation, immunity, metabolism, and cellular senescence as core pillars of aging, all amenable to targeted strategies.
